The death of a 28-year-old man found outside a vacant Coral Springs business Tuesday has been ruled a homicide, police said.
A passerby saw the body of Kinolee Gardner around 9:30 a.m. in front of a former swimming pool business at 10950 Wiles Rd. and called 911, police said.
The homicide investigation is ongoing, Coral Springs Police Sgt. Ernesto Bruna said Wednesday.
Additional information about the case, including how Gardner was killed, has not been made public.
